The field device management market size has grown strongly in recent years. It will grow from $2.24 billion in 2025 to $2.44 billion in 2026 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 9.1%. The growth in the historic period can be attributed to increasing industrial automation, adoption of early device monitoring tools, rising need for equipment efficiency, shift toward digital troubleshooting, growth in industrial networking.

The field device management market size is expected to see strong growth in the next few years. It will grow to $3.46 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 9.1%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to rising use of predictive maintenance, expansion of connected industrial assets, increasing migration to cloud-based device management, growing demand for real-time diagnostics, adoption of advanced asset intelligence platforms. Major trends in the forecast period include increasing emphasis on advanced diagnostics for field devices, rising adoption of predictive maintenance tools in industrial operations, growing demand for unified device configuration platforms, expansion of multi-protocol support for diverse industrial assets, increased focus on enhancing asset availability through intelligent monitoring.

The growing adoption of smart factories is expected to drive the growth of the field device management market in the coming years. A smart factory represents the seamless connection of individual production steps, from planning stages to actuators in the field. Smart factories and automation help deliver exceptional customer experiences by streamlining processes and automating routine tasks in field service operations. For example, in March 2024, Rockwell Automation, Inc., a US-based automation company, reported that 95% of manufacturers are currently using or evaluating smart manufacturing, a notable increase from 83% the previous year. Additionally, 94% of these manufacturers expect to maintain or expand their workforce due to the adoption of smart manufacturing technologies. Consequently, the rising adoption of smart factories is fueling the growth of the field device management market.

Prominent companies in the field device management market are channeling their focus into creating cutting-edge solutions, with a particular emphasis on innovations such as field information manager systems. A field information manager is typically a system or tool crafted to effectively manage and organize information collected or generated in the field. As an example, in December 2023, ABB, a Switzerland-based leader in automation technology, unveiled the 'ABB Ability Field Information Manager (FIM 3.0)'. This system elevates engineering efficiency and productivity for clusters of field instrumentation fleets. The ABB Ability Field Information Manager empowers businesses to embrace digital transformation, ensuring adaptability, efficiency, and competitiveness across their spectrum of devices.

In June 2024, FieldComm Group, a US-based provider of both hardware and software tools for automation, acquired the assets of FDT Group, including the Field Device Tool/Device Type Manager (FDT/DTM) technology standards, for an undisclosed amount. The acquisition aims to address the challenges of managing industrial devices and improve operational efficiency for vendors and end users across various automation markets. FDT Group is a Belgium-based international non-profit organization that provides an open standard for enterprise-wide network and asset integration in industrial automation.

Tariffs are affecting the field device management market by increasing the cost of imported sensors, communication modules, and electronic components essential for hardware-based field devices. Hardware segments such as field sensors, gateways, and connectivity solutions are particularly impacted, with Asia-Pacific and Europe experiencing the strongest effects due to reliance on global supply chains. While tariffs elevate production costs and slow deployment timelines, they also encourage local sourcing, stimulate domestic manufacturing of industrial components, and drive innovation in software-based device management that reduces dependency on high-cost hardware imports.

Field device management serves as a maintenance and configuration tool for applications requiring diagnostics, troubleshooting, and configuration of smart field equipment. It utilizes predictive intelligence to enhance the performance and availability of crucial production assets.

The primary types of offerings in field device management are hardware and software. Hardware encompasses the physical components used for taking input data from the user, storing data, displaying output, and executing commands. These components play a crucial role in the overall functionality of field device management systems. Field device management involves the use of different protocols such as Foundation Fieldbus, HART, Profibus, Profinet, Modbus TCP or IP, Ethernet or IP, and others. These protocols can be deployed either in on-premises systems or in the cloud, providing flexibility in the implementation of field device management solutions. Field device management solutions are utilized across various industries, including process industries and discrete industries, where they contribute to the effective monitoring, control, and maintenance of field devices and systems.North America was the largest region in the field device management market in 2025. Asia-Pacific is expected to be the fastest-growing region in the forecast period.
